时间:2025-02-03 12:01:50
count语句怎么用
在SQL中,count语句主要用于计算数据的行数。
具体使用方法如下:
1. count(*) 、count(1):这两个的使用方法和结果是相同的。表示返回所有的行,经常使用在没有where条件的语句中,速度较快。
2. count(column):返回字段在表中出现的次数,不包括有null值。
3. count(distinct column) :返回列中不包含指定字段为null的唯一行数。
4. count(expression):返回不包含 NULL 值的行数,expression 是表达式。
在使用count函数的时候,优先使用count(*)进行查询,在where条件中 减少使用 age=1,(如果这个字段没有建立索引,查询就直接不走索引,直接扫描全表)。在count(column)中最好column也是主键,这样才会直接走索引,提高查询的效率。
需要注意的是,count函数在不同的上下文中可能有不同的含义,例如在Excel中,count函数用于计算含有数值或者内容的单元格的数量。在英语中,count则表示计算、计数。
《count函数的用法》不代表本网站观点,如有侵权请联系我们删除